PM Modi's Letter A Lifelong Inspiration For Me: Vandana Katariya
On April 1, the 32-year-old forward formally announced her retirement from international hockey, closing a chapter that began in 2009 and saw her become India’s most-capped women’s hockey player. With 320 international caps and 158 goals to her name, Vandana leaves behind a legacy unmatched in the history of the sport in India.
“It is a proud moment for me to receive a letter of appreciation from Hon’ble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i Ji on my hockey career and retirement. I am overwhelmed to receive this honour. This affection and encouragement will always be an inspiration for me. Thank you Prime Minister,” Vandana posted on X.
